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
45b The Mall Ealing, London, United Kingdom, W5 3TJ
79 College Rd. Harrow, Greater London, United Kingdom, HA1 1BD
133 London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 6NH
Canbury Business Centre, 50, Canbury Prk.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 6LX
Power Rd. Studios 114 Power Rd. Hounslow, London, United Kingdom, W4 5PY
Dove Commercial Centre Unit 15, 109 Bartholomew Rd. Camden, London, United Kingdom, NW5 2BJ
103 Longhurst Rd. Lewisham, Greater London, United Kingdom, SE13 5NA
Hop Studios 2 Jamaica Rd. Southwark, Greater London, United Kingdom, SE1 2BX
1 Bermondsey Sq. Southwark, Greater London, United Kingdom, SE1 3UN
Trafalgar House, Grenville Plc. Barnet, London, United Kingdom, NW7 3SA